The 2025 Master Classics of Poker Hits Holland Casino this November

The schedule is out for the Netherlands’ premier poker tournament series, Master Classics of Poker, one of the longest-running festivals in Europe. The 2025 MCOP will return to Holland Casino in Amsterdam Centrum from November 14-22. The 33rd edition of the MCOP features buy-ins ranging from €330 up to €10,300, including the headlining €3,000 MCOP Main Event.

MCOP has also added two new High Roller events in the €10,300 No Limit Hold’em and Pot Limit Omaha High Rollers. Players can also save the €300 entry fee by pre-registering for either event. The schedule has been juiced up to 22 events, which also includes a €1,650 Re-Entry event to kick things off, a €2,200 NLH and PLO Mystery Bounty, a €3,000 PLO, and a €1,100 PKO Bounty event.

History of the Master Classics of Poker

The MCOP first debuted in 1992 and has been played every year since. 2025 marks the 33rd time poker players from around the world have flocked to Amsterdam. The MCOP Main Event trophy has been labelled as one of the most sought-after, prestigious titles a player can win on the felt. Some big-name champions have captured the title, including Julien Sitbon (2022), Noah Boeken (2013), Ole Schemion (2012), Robert Mizrachi (2004), and original Hendon Mobster Ram Vaswani (1999).

€3,000 MCOP Main Event (Nov 18-22)

Last year’s MCOP Main Event drew 427 total entries, creating a prize pool worth €1,150,756. Finland’s Eero Abbey emerged victorious, taking home €203,800. There were three local hopefuls in the mix in the final five, with Derk Van Luijk busting fifth, Erik van den Berg out in third, and Jeroen Kalthof finishing runner-up for €135,675.

This year’s MCOP Main Event begins on Tuesday, November 18th, with the first of three Day 1 starting flights. Day 1A and 1B feature 60-minute levels while Day 1C has 30-minute levels. All flights begin with 40,000 in chips and boast unlimited re-entries. Day 2 is scheduled for the 20th with 75-minute levels followed by the final day of play on the 21st.

MCOP Side Events and Satellites

Alongside the Main Event, the 2025 Master Classics of Poker will feature a rich schedule of side events designed to suit a wide range of players. These include buy‑ins mostly in the €330‑€1,650 range for tournaments like turbo NLH, PLO, deep stacks, bounty and mystery bounty formats. There are also larger buy-in events, including two €10,300 High Rollers (NLH & PLO) for those seeking high stakes. In addition, numerous satellites (both online and live) give players affordable pathways into these side events and the Main Event itself.

The €1,650 Re-Entry event gets the festival underway this year once again after attracting 306 entries in 2024. The prize pool closed at €445,230 with Dutch player Wouter Beltz winning €91,361 and getting the home crowd on the board early.
